BREVARD COUNTY • COCOA BEACH, FLORIDA – Earlier this week, the Cocoa Beach Regional Chamber of Commerce is pleased to announce the selection of Marshall Hooks as its next Convention and Visitors Bureau (CVB) Director.

Hooks hails from Dawson, Georgia and is currently the President & CEO of the Barnesville Lamar County Chamber of Commerce.

With over three combined years of Chamber experience, Hooks brings with him a wealth of knowledge and a love of tourism and fundraising.

Hooks holds a Bachelor of Arts in Political Science and a Masters of Public Administration from Georgia Southern University in Statesboro, Georgia.

“I am truly honored and blessed to have been selected as the Director of the Cocoa Beach Regional Chamber of Commerce’s CVB,” said Hooks.

“I have big shoes to fill and I am excited to work with Jennifer, the Chamber team, the partners, and the community to continue promoting the Cocoa Beach area as one of Florida’s top tourist destinations.”

Hooks will begin his new role at the Chamber’s CVB on Monday, September 21.

“I am thrilled to welcome Marshall aboard and I have every confidence in his skill set and ability to bring a fresh vision to our CVB,” said Jennifer Sugarman, President & CEO of the Cocoa Beach Regional Chamber of Commerce.

“Marshall’s love of tourism and chamber work in general will make him an excellent addition to our CVB, our team and our community.”
